Galen Miller, Ph.D.
Galen Miller, Ph.D. is the Executive Vice President of the National Hospice and Palliative Care Organization. Immediately prior to joining NHPCO, Galen served as Vice President of Professional Services (Professional Education, Membership, Corporate Relations, Marketing/Customer Service, Business Advancement, Health Information Services, Executive Education, Minority Training and Meeting Services) for the American Association of Health Plans in Washington, DC. AAHP is the national trade organization representing over 1,200 health maintenance organizations, preferred provider network organizations and other group health plans across the nation that provide care for over 160 million Americans nationwide. Prior to joining the AAHP staff in July of 1998, Galen served for seven years as Vice President and Director of Professional Development, Research and External Relations for the National Hospice Organization. In addition to education, research and external relations, Galen provided leadership for NHPCO in HIV/AIDS care, Access to Hospice Care, Rural Initiatives, Strategic Planning and for the development of the Library and Information Center.Galen holds his undergraduate degree from the University of Nebraska-Lincoln, his MS from the College of Business Administration at Utah State University, Logan, UT, and his Doctorate in Administration, Curriculum and Instruction from the University of Nebraska-Lincoln. He has served in state administrative roles for the Nebraska Department of Education and the Colorado Community College and Occupational Education System. Galen also has experience as a secondary classroom teacher, and as a member of the faculty at Colorado State University in Fort Collins, CO and has held both faculty and administrative appointments at California State Polytechnic University in Pomona, CA.
